Output 30043cc70117f1124d6d81ff809740bdda4dfd381a2ec1a905c87b001a91e2c8:1

value
999325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a9fda06c5232fd136abe157519963e950618190 OP_EQUAL
address
372zcMjpERQMxJpXYXiJdV9R6G4EZWXuZf
transaction
30043cc70117f1124d6d81ff809740bdda4dfd381a2ec1a905c87b001a91e2c8
spent
true